Quote:
Originally Posted by Unregistered
Is there anyone who appealed for their performance grade (e.g. C minus) before? What is the chance of success?
|
1st things first, C minus is below average already, so confirm the school has some documented information before they can assign you with this (been in ranking panel for some time and A graders, B with higher quantums, C-/D graders, all need some form of justification and documentation. For my school at least.
You should already have a generic sensing before you get this grade right? Schools don't just give C minus or D to people. Usually once mistakes are made, or you are falling short of the expectations your subgrade comes with, the RO will usually inform you, or let you know that this will affect your ranking.
Unless your case is the school suddenly just put you C minus, without any prior informing, if not I don't think you stand a good chance of success. Some schools may not be direct and just let you know e.g. your classroom management currently is below par, or that your T&L side not good etc.
Of course, if your C minus is because of some mistakes that you've made (in most cases there are), such as my school (e.g. GEO 5 but didn't lead their PD team properly, exam setting copy from other sources but never declare, department worksheets never complete but chuck it in the classroom, ethos issues etc.) then 0% le. Because facts are there.
